Tiffany Justice

Co-founder of Moms For Liberty, a grassroots organization dedicated to fighting for liberty and parental rights in education; wife and mother of four.

Episode 4593: Trump Continues To Have Major Victories In The Courts

Julie Kelly, a political commentator focused on the January 6th Capitol riot, joins Tiffany Justice, co-founder of Moms for Liberty, to discuss significant Supreme Court victories impacting Trump's policies and parental rights in education. They analyze the implications of recent rulings on nationwide injunctions and judicial dynamics. The conversation also highlights grassroots advocacy for parental rights, the importance of family values in education, and the ongoing battles surrounding birthright citizenship, showcasing a pivotal moment in legal discourse.

Moms For Liberty Co-Founder Tiffany Justice | PBD Podcast | Ep. 368

Tiffany Justice, co-founder of Moms For Liberty and mother of four, passionately discusses the fight for parental rights in education. She shares her experiences debating controversial topics, including explicit content in school books and the influence of teacher unions. Tiffany reveals strategies for parents with limited resources to advocate for their children, and emphasizes the significance of grassroots activism. The conversation also touches on the impact of COVID-19 and the complexities of navigating education in today's polarized climate.
